Overview
ConvertKit is an email marketing platform tailored for solo creators and content producers who need to build and manage their subscriber lists efficiently. It offers a free plan with generous limits, making it accessible even for those just starting out. ConvertKit's core value proposition lies in its simplicity and ease of use, allowing users to create engaging newsletters, forms, and landing pages without the complexity often associated with email marketing tools. However, as your subscriber base grows beyond 1,000 users, costs escalate significantly, making it less cost-effective for solo founders or freelancers who are scaling their operations.
Why Look Elsewhere
Solo founders, freelancers, and indie hackers might find themselves looking for alternatives to ConvertKit due to several pain points:
Pricing Cliffs: As your subscriber base grows beyond 1,000 users, costs escalate significantly. The pricing model can become prohibitive for those scaling their operations.
Limited Automation on Free Plan: Only one automation process is available on the free plan, which might not be sufficient for more complex workflows.
No Offline Access: Since ConvertKit is an online service, you cannot access or manage campaigns without internet connectivity. This can be a drawback if you need to work in areas with limited network coverage.
